Madonna banned from horse riding while on tour

Madonna will not be able to ride horses while she is on tour as her insurance policy will not allow it.

The pop superstar fell off in April this year while riding in the Hamptons, New York, and injured her back after her horse was reportedly spooked by paparazzi.

Later it was revealed that the statement made by the singer's publicist contradicted that of the police report and Madonna did not report the cause of the accident as paparazzi.

She reportedly recently told US talk show host David Letterman she hadn't ridden since the accident and that her insurance company wouldn't not allow her to ride while she's touring.
